Schriftart in Clean Thesis Version v0.4.1 2020/06/17 ändern

Schriftart in Clean Thesis Version v0.4.1 2020/06/17 ändern

Ich verwende die saubere Abschlussarbeitsvorlage, um eine Abschlussarbeit zu schreiben. Das sieht gut aus, aber ich möchte die Schriftart des Haupttextes ändern incomicneue.

Bearbeitet: Ich übergebe die Option zur Verwendung von serifenloser Schrift in den Paketoptionen: \PassOptionsToPackage{...., sansserif=true,...}{cleanthesis}

Außerdem habe ich den Codeabschnitt in cleanthesis.sty gefunden, in dem davon ausgegangen wird, dass die Vorlage die Änderung von Serifenschrift auf serifenlose Schrift unter Verwendung der definierten Schriftarten vornimmt:

\RequirePackage[T1]{fontenc}        % font types and character verification
% \ifthenelse{\boolean{@sansserif}}%
\ifct@cthesis@sansserif
%   {
% Using sans-serif fonts
%       \RequirePackage{helvet}
%       \RequirePackage{opensans}
%       \RequirePackage{comicneue}
        \RequirePackage{libertine}
%       \RequirePackage{tgadventor}
        \renewcommand*\familydefault{\sfdefault}%
%   }{%
\else
        % Using serif fonts
%       \RequirePackage{lmodern}    % font set: Latin Modern
%       \RequirePackage{charter}    % font set: Charter
%   }
\fi

Ich habe den Code auskommentiert, sodass die Vorlagecomicneueals Schriftart SS. Aus irgendeinem Grund ändert sich die Schriftart jedoch nicht.

Ich habe es in Libertine geändert, um zu prüfen, ob der Code funktioniert, und ja, die Schriftart ändert sich: Bildbeschreibung hier eingeben

Aber wenn ich es ändere incomicneue, die Schriftart „kehrt zurück“ zu dem, was für mich wie eine standardmäßige serifenlose Schriftart für die Klasse scrreprt aussieht (ich weiß nicht, ob das stimmt).

Bildbeschreibung hier eingeben

Ich habe beim Laden des Pakets beides versucht, mit und ohne die Option [Standard], aber ohne Erfolg.

Mehr als die spezifischencomicneueSchriftart, was ich suche, ist eine Schriftart im Haupttext zu verwenden, die die BuchstabenAUndGes scheint, als ob wir es von Hand machen. Also, ich habe es auch mit versuchtTEX Gyre Adventor tgadventor qagaber ohne Erfolg. Interessant ist, dass ich für die Kapitel- und Abschnittsschriftart dieselbe Schriftart qag verwende und die Vorlage diese akzeptiert, aber nicht für den Haupttext.

\newcommand{\tgherosfont}{\fontfamily{qag}\selectfont}
\newcommand{\thesischapterfont}{\color{ctcolorblack}\nobreak\normalfont\huge\fontfamily{qag}\selectfont}
\newcommand{\thesissectionfont}{\color{ctcolorsection}\nobreak\normalfont\Large\tgherosfont}

Irgendein Vorschlag?

Dank im Voraus!

Antwort1

In cleanthesis.styfinden wir

% own font definitions
\newcommand{\helv}{\fontfamily{phv}\fontsize{9}{11}\selectfont}
\newcommand{\book}{\fontfamily{pbk}\fontseries{m}\fontsize{11}{13}\selectfont}
\newcommand{\tgherosfont}{\fontfamily{qhv}\selectfont}

\newcommand{\thesispartlabelfont}{\color{ctcolorpartnum}\nobreak\book\fontsize{60}{60}\selectfont}
\newcommand{\thesispartfont}{\color{ctcolorparttext}\nobreak\normalfont\huge \tgherosfont\selectfont}
\newcommand{\thesischapterfont}{\color{ctcolorblack}\nobreak\normalfont\huge \fontfamily{phv}\selectfont}
%\newcommand{\thesissectionfont}{\color{ctcolormain}\nobreak\LARGE\bfseries \tgherosfont}
\newcommand{\thesissectionfont}{\color{ctcolorsection}\nobreak\normalfont\LARGE \tgherosfont}
\newcommand{\thesissubsectionfont}{\color{ctcolorsubsection}\nobreak\normalfont\Large \tgherosfont}
\newcommand{\thesisparagraphfont}{\color{ctcolorparagraph}\nobreak\tgherosfont\small\bfseries}

\newcommand{\ctfontfooterpagenumber}{%
    \color{ctcolorfooterpage}%
    \normalfont\normalsize\bfseries \tgherosfont%
}
\newcommand{\ctfontfootertext}{%
    \color{ctcolorfootertitle}%
    \normalfont\footnotesize \tgherosfont%
}
%
% headings
\setkomafont{part}{\thesispartfont} % for chapter entries
\setkomafont{chapter}{\thesischapterfont} % for chapter entries
\setkomafont{section}{\thesissectionfont} % for section entries
\setkomafont{subsection}{\thesissubsectionfont} % for section entries
\addtokomafont{subsubsection}{\tgherosfont}
%\addtokomafont{paragraph}{\tgherosfont}
\setkomafont{paragraph}{\thesisparagraphfont}

was wirklich umstritten ist. Es ist nicht klar, warum qbk(Bookman) für Teile verwendet wird: Es ist eine Serifenschrift, die mit keiner der anderen Optionen wirklich kompatibel ist. Warum abwechselnd zwischen phv(Helvetica) und qhv(Heros)? Warum die offensichtlich falschen \nobreakBefehle?

Möglicherweise möchten Sie die Definitionen der Schriftarten ändern, die in den Abschnittstiteln verwendet werden sollen \normalfont.

\documentclass[a4paper]{scrbook}
\usepackage[
  sansserif,
]{cleanthesis}
\usepackage[default]{comicneue}

\renewcommand{\thesispartlabelfont}{\color{ctcolorpartnum}\fontsize{60}{60}\normalfont}
\renewcommand{\thesispartfont}{\color{ctcolorparttext}\normalfont\huge\bfseries}
\renewcommand{\thesischapterfont}{\color{ctcolorblack}\normalfont\huge\bfseries}
\renewcommand{\thesissectionfont}{\color{ctcolorsection}\normalfont\LARGE}
\renewcommand{\thesissubsectionfont}{\color{ctcolorsubsection}\normalfont\Large}
\renewcommand{\thesisparagraphfont}{\color{ctcolorparagraph}\normalfont\small\bfseries}
\renewcommand{\ctfontfooterpagenumber}{\color{ctcolorfooterpage}\normalfont\normalsize\bfseries}
\renewcommand{\ctfontfootertext}{\color{ctcolorfootertitle}\normalfont\footnotesize}

\begin{document}

\chapter{Test}

This is a test

\section{Test}

This is a test

\end{document}

Bildbeschreibung hier eingeben

Eine These ist eineERNSTDokument. ComicNeue ist zwar nicht so hässlich wie ComicSans, abervöllig unangebrachtfür ein seriöses Dokument.

Würden Sie die Verfassung Ihres Landes gern so gedruckt sehen? Oder glauben Sie, dass irgendjemand überhaupt auf die Idee käme, eine päpstliche Bulle in ComicNeue abzudrucken? Ihre Abschlussarbeit ist das Ergebnis jahrelanger Studien, machen Sie sich nicht darüber lustig.

Sind Sie bereit, hochgezogene Augenbrauen oder sogar Gelächter zu akzeptieren, wenn das Komitee mit der Prüfung Ihrer Abschlussarbeit beginnt? Ich glaube nicht.

Lassen Sie es so cleanthesis. Es ist schlecht geschrieben. Wenn Sie darauf bestehen, lassen Sie die sansserifOption so. Und behalten Sie diese Neudefinitionen bei, damit die Schriftarten für die Titel nicht in irgendeiner zufälligen Schriftart festgelegt werden.

\documentclass[a4paper]{scrbook}
\usepackage{cleanthesis}
\usepackage{cochineal}

\renewcommand{\thesispartlabelfont}{\color{ctcolorpartnum}\fontsize{60}{60}\normalfont}
\renewcommand{\thesispartfont}{\color{ctcolorparttext}\normalfont\huge\bfseries}
\renewcommand{\thesischapterfont}{\color{ctcolorblack}\normalfont\huge\bfseries}
\renewcommand{\thesissectionfont}{\color{ctcolorsection}\normalfont\LARGE}
\renewcommand{\thesissubsectionfont}{\color{ctcolorsubsection}\normalfont\Large}
\renewcommand{\thesisparagraphfont}{\color{ctcolorparagraph}\normalfont\small\bfseries}
\renewcommand{\ctfontfooterpagenumber}{\color{ctcolorfooterpage}\normalfont\normalsize\bfseries}
\renewcommand{\ctfontfootertext}{\color{ctcolorfootertitle}\normalfont\footnotesize}

\begin{document}

\chapter{Test}

This is a test

\section{Test}

This is a test

\end{document}

Bildbeschreibung hier eingeben

verwandte Informationen